Prime Video Unveils 'Gen V' Season 2 Trailer Highlighting New Secrets and Intense Drama

WHAT'S THE STORY?

What's Happening?

Prime Video has released the trailer for the second season of 'Gen V', a spinoff of the popular series 'The Boys'. The trailer was unveiled during a Comic-Con session, featuring cast members such as Jaz Sinclair, Maddie Phillips, and showrunner Michele Fazekas. The new season continues to explore the intense and often gory world of Godolkin University, where young superheroes, or 'supes', are trained. The storyline picks up with the characters dealing with the aftermath of previous events, as they navigate a brewing conflict between humans and supes. The trailer also introduces new characters, including Thomas Godolkin, played by Ethan Slater, and highlights the promotion of Sean Patrick Thomas to a series regular. The series is produced by Sony Pictures TV and Amazon MGM Studios, with a team of executive producers including Eric Kripke and Seth Rogen.
